Lilly was dumped in a shelter after she had her babies.  She was in a kill shelter and pulled the day she was to be euthanized   Her foster mom in North Carolina says she is as sweet as can be,  great with other dogs and children.   She is approx. 5 years old,  spayed, up to date on shots and ready to finally find someone to love her forever.

Tommy and Timmy are two wired terrier type dogs rescued from a kill shelter in North Carolina.  They are 6 months old and between 15-20 lbs.  They are up to date on shots and searching for their forever homes. Tommy is a little shy at first, but totally sweet and warms up easily.  He's a funny little guy, low key, gets along with the other dogs in his foster home, from small to large.  Is good on a leash, but also loves to run in the yard and play.

Remy, Rudy, & Ramsey! This litter of 6 was dumped in a shelter at 3 weeks old.  They were brought right to a foster home and bottle fed until they were old enough to eat on their own.  All have different coloring, all very unique but equally cute.  Playful and happy pups are hoping to find their forever homes.

Cece is an approximately 3 year old girl, about 45 lbs, looking for a new home.  Her parents say they think she is lab, basset hound, pug mix.  She is black with a brown stripe down the center of her back and brown eyes.. She gets along great with other dogs. She is spayed and all of her shots are up to date.  She's a pretty girl, with a great personality, great with kids and loves to play and loves to take walks.

Scooter is a shy Shih Tzu mix that someone dumped in the shelter.  He was very scared there and did not do well in a shelter environment,  so he would have been the first to go.  We feel that he will show his true colors once in a foster home,  with the love he deserves.  We'll get him groomed and all ready to find his forever family.

Polly was dumped in a kill shelter in Tennessee.  She is super sweet,  great with other dogs, people,  kids,  just about anyone that crosses her path.  She is housebroken, up to date on all shots, microchipped, and spayed.
